Koolhaas Houselife is a film about The House in Bordeaux, designed in 1998 by Rem Koolhaas / OMA. The centerpiece of this house is an elevator platform the size of a room which connects the three levels of the house, creating a fully accessible living space for the owner who lived in a wheelchair.

Universal design is the design of products and environments to be usable by all people, to the greatest extent possible, without the need for adaptation or specialized design. –Ron Mace
